Ben Kweller has been called everything from balladeer to punk rocker, anti-folker to indie-popper. His ability to weave together opposites that coexist happily on the same album is something few can do. Kweller has been on the road as a solo artist since 2001 and made a name for himself touring with the likes of Guster, Jeff Tweedy and Death Cab for Cutie. In 2003 he joined forces with Ben Folds and Ben Lee to tour and record a four song EP as “The Bens.”

The Dig are a rock band from NYC. Their music, written by the bands’ three main songwriters, draws on influences from early rock and roll and rural folk and blues to new wave and modern rock bands. The Dig’s two singers Emile Mosseri and David Baldwin have been making music in various bands together since they were 11 years old. They met up with keyboardist/guitarist Erick Eiser while still in high school, and after writing music together throughout college they eventually moved to New York CIty and formed The Dig.
